Now ID cards a must for train journey from Feb 15

"This has been done to keep a check on passengers travelling on transferred tickets," he said.
The rule will come into effect from Feb 15, for passengers issued tickets from the internet (i-ticket), Passenger Reservation System, undertaking journey in AC chair car, AC-2tier, AC-3 tier and executive classes. As of now, only passengers travelling on a tatkal or an e-ticket are required to carry I-cards.
Passengers can carry along their Photo identity card, Voter ID Card, PAN card, DL, Passport, with the state/central government issued serial number, aadhar card, student id card with photograph issued by recognized school/college, bank issued credit cards with laminated photograph, nationalised bank passbook with photograph.
Passengers failing to carry the required proof will be treated as 'Without Ticket' and charged accordingly.
To generate awareness among the passengers, the railways will soon start printing the message on the tickets.
